    We are looking to hire a skilled WordPress admin and/or developer to design, implement, and maintain our web properties.

    As the Web/SaaS Administrator on ASA's Technology team you will be responsible for both back-end and front-end configuration and development including the implementation of WordPress themes and plugins as well as site integrations and security updates.

    You should have in-depth knowledge of front-end programming languages, a good eye for aesthetics, and strong content management skills. Proficiency in Salesforce is desired but not necessary.

    To be successful in this role, you must be able to thrive and succeed in a fast-paced environment, prioritize the needs of multiple stakeholders, and be willing to help the team complete SaaS solution and cloud infrastructure needs beyond those strictly related to the web site.

    You must approach problems from a customer-centric and systems-design perspective, while ensuring that your skills are constantly evolving to meet best-practices.


    Major Responsibilities:
    Meeting with internal and external stakeholders to discuss website design and function
    Designing and building the website front-end
    Creating and evolving the website architecture
    Designing and managing the website back-end including database and server integrations
    Generating WordPress themes and plugins in the WP-Engine environment
    Conducting website performance tests
    Troubleshooting content issues
    Create SOP documentation and conduct WordPress training with the stakeholders as necessary
    Monitoring the performance of the live website
    WordPress development and administration including management of the patching and security update processes across all environments
    Search Engine Optimization
    Performs all other duties as assigned

    Required Education, Experience, and Skills:
    Bachelor's degree in computer engineering or computer science, or the equivalent work experience
    3+ years of experience as a web developer with emphasis on responsive web applications
    Proven work experience as a WordPress developer or administrator
    Experience building a website that involved several API integrations
    Knowledge of back-end technologies including PHP and
    Knowledge of current DevOps practices for web development, security, and release management such as use of YAML, Docker and SNYK
    Knowledge of code versioning tools such as GitHub or CodeCommit
    Good understanding of website architecture and aesthetics
    Ability to self-manage small projects
    Advanced troubleshooting skills
